So, If I upload a video and then try to post it, I get a 401 unauthorized exception. This is pretty much guaranteed to happen every time I try.
Clearly my fault right? Well no.

Through trial and error, I found out that if I spam two uploads/posts within a second, both will successfully post.

My hack solution right now, to force it to work, is to spam three uploads at the same time, with a 1/10 second delay between the start of each, and when the third is finished uploading make the post. Works every time.

The code I’m using, completely unchanged, worked a month ago without hacks.

Posting plain messages and images works without a hitch. The only issue I’m having is with videos.


@Regaerd Are you receiving 401 from /1.1/statuses/update.json (create tweet) api? Please could you provide more information?



Yes, I was getting a 401 on /1.1/statuses/update.json, which I could mitigate by spamming uploads.
However, the issue went away sometime yesterday without any changes on my end.

I assumed someone had fixed a server-side issue, but maybe it’s just intermittent.

For the record, I’m using STTwitter for all of the API interactions.

@Regaerd That is quite possible. I am going to close this thread. Please let us know if you come across this issue again.